.elementor-13669 .elementor-element.elementor-element-113d285{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-13669 .elementor-element.elementor-element-53efc68{--display:flex;}.elementor-widget-call-to-action .elementor-cta__title{font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-weight:var( --e-global-typography-primary-font-weight );}.elementor-widget-call-to-action .elementor-cta__description{font-family:var( --e-global-typography-text-font-family ), Sans-serif;}.elementor-widget-call-to-action .elementor-cta__button{font-family:var( --e-global-typography-accent-font-family ), Sans-serif;}.elementor-widget-call-to-action .elementor-ribbon-inner{background-color:var( --e-global-color-accent );font-family:var( --e-global-typography-accent-font-family ), Sans-serif;}.elementor-13669 .elementor-element.elementor-element-7eb7b95 .elementor-cta .elementor-cta__bg, .elementor-13669 .elementor-element.elementor-element-7eb7b95 .elementor-cta .elementor-cta__bg-overlay{transition-duration:1500ms;}.elementor-13669 .elementor-element.elementor-element-7eb7b95{width:auto;max-width:auto;background-color:#46319200;}.elementor-13669 .elementor-element.elementor-element-7eb7b95.elementor-element{--align-self:center;}.elementor-13669 .elementor-element.elementor-element-7eb7b95 .elementor-cta__content{text-align:center;padding:0px 0px 0px 0px;}.elementor-13669 .elementor-element.elementor-element-7eb7b95 .elementor-cta__button{font-family:"HvDTrial_PlutoCondBlack", Sans-serif;font-size:24px;text-transform:none;color:#FFFFFF;background-color:#02010100;border-color:#02010100;border-width:0px;border-radius:0px;padding:15px 15px 15px 15px;}.elementor-13669 .elementor-element.elementor-element-7eb7b95 .elementor-cta__button:hover{color:#FFFFFF;background-color:#02010100;}.elementor-13669 .elementor-element.elementor-element-7eb7b95 .elementor-cta:not(:hover) .elementor-cta__bg-overlay{background-color:#02010100;}.elementor-13669 .elementor-element.elementor-element-7eb7b95 .elementor-cta:hover .elementor-cta__bg-overlay{background-color:#02010100;}.elementor-13669 .elementor-element.elementor-element-e0ec488{--display:flex;}.elementor-13669 .elementor-element.elementor-element-b72a86d .elementor-cta .elementor-cta__bg, .elementor-13669 .elementor-element.elementor-element-b72a86d .elementor-cta .elementor-cta__bg-overlay{transition-duration:1500ms;}.elementor-13669 .elementor-element.elementor-element-b72a86d{width:auto;max-width:auto;background-color:#46319200;}.elementor-13669 .elementor-element.elementor-element-b72a86d.elementor-element{--align-self:center;}.elementor-13669 .elementor-element.elementor-element-b72a86d .elementor-cta__content{text-align:center;padding:0px 0px 0px 0px;}.elementor-13669 .elementor-element.elementor-element-b72a86d .elementor-cta__button{font-family:"HvDTrial_PlutoCondBlack", Sans-serif;font-size:24px;text-transform:none;color:#FFFFFF;background-color:#02010100;border-color:#02010100;border-width:0px;border-radius:0px;padding:15px 15px 15px 15px;}.elementor-13669 .elementor-element.elementor-element-b72a86d .elementor-cta__button:hover{color:#FFFFFF;background-color:#02010100;}.elementor-13669 .elementor-element.elementor-element-b72a86d .elementor-cta:not(:hover) .elementor-cta__bg-overlay{background-color:#02010100;}.elementor-13669 .elementor-element.elementor-element-b72a86d .elementor-cta:hover .elementor-cta__bg-overlay{background-color:#02010100;}.elementor-13669 .elementor-element.elementor-element-f02d0c5{--display:flex;}.elementor-13669 .elementor-element.elementor-element-1e2a572 .elementor-cta .elementor-cta__bg, .elementor-13669 .elementor-element.elementor-element-1e2a572 .elementor-cta .elementor-cta__bg-overlay{transition-duration:1500ms;}.elementor-13669 .elementor-element.elementor-element-1e2a572{width:auto;max-width:auto;background-color:#46319200;}.elementor-13669 .elementor-element.elementor-element-1e2a572.elementor-element{--align-self:center;}.elementor-13669 .elementor-element.elementor-element-1e2a572 .elementor-cta__content{text-align:center;padding:0px 0px 0px 0px;}.elementor-13669 .elementor-element.elementor-element-1e2a572 .elementor-cta__button{font-family:"HvDTrial_PlutoCondBlack", Sans-serif;font-size:24px;text-transform:none;color:#FFFFFF;background-color:#02010100;border-color:#02010100;border-width:0px;border-radius:0px;padding:15px 15px 15px 15px;}.elementor-13669 .elementor-element.elementor-element-1e2a572 .elementor-cta__button:hover{color:#FFFFFF;background-color:#02010100;}.elementor-13669 .elementor-element.elementor-element-1e2a572 .elementor-cta:not(:hover) .elementor-cta__bg-overlay{background-color:#02010100;}.elementor-13669 .elementor-element.elementor-element-1e2a572 .elementor-cta:hover .elementor-cta__bg-overlay{background-color:#02010100;}.elementor-13669 .elementor-element.elementor-element-dc7605e{--display:flex;}.elementor-13669 .elementor-element.elementor-element-cc42510 .elementor-cta .elementor-cta__bg, .elementor-13669 .elementor-element.elementor-element-cc42510 .elementor-cta .elementor-cta__bg-overlay{transition-duration:1500ms;}.elementor-13669 .elementor-element.elementor-element-cc42510{width:auto;max-width:auto;background-color:#46319200;}.elementor-13669 .elementor-element.elementor-element-cc42510.elementor-element{--align-self:center;}.elementor-13669 .elementor-element.elementor-element-cc42510 .elementor-cta__content{text-align:center;padding:0px 0px 0px 0px;}.elementor-13669 .elementor-element.elementor-element-cc42510 .elementor-cta__button{font-family:"HvDTrial_PlutoCondBlack", Sans-serif;font-size:24px;text-transform:none;color:#FFFFFF;background-color:#02010100;border-color:#02010100;border-width:0px;border-radius:0px;padding:15px 15px 15px 15px;}.elementor-13669 .elementor-element.elementor-element-cc42510 .elementor-cta__button:hover{color:#FFFFFF;background-color:#02010100;}.elementor-13669 .elementor-element.elementor-element-cc42510 .elementor-cta:not(:hover) .elementor-cta__bg-overlay{background-color:#02010100;}.elementor-13669 .elementor-element.elementor-element-cc42510 .elementor-cta:hover .elementor-cta__bg-overlay{background-color:#02010100;}.elementor-13669 .elementor-element.elementor-element-3821a1f{--display:flex;}.elementor-13669 .elementor-element.elementor-element-4577679 .elementor-cta .elementor-cta__bg, .elementor-13669 .elementor-element.elementor-element-4577679 .elementor-cta .elementor-cta__bg-overlay{transition-duration:1500ms;}.elementor-13669 .elementor-element.elementor-element-4577679{width:auto;max-width:auto;background-color:#46319200;}.elementor-13669 .elementor-element.elementor-element-4577679.elementor-element{--align-self:center;}.elementor-13669 .elementor-element.elementor-element-4577679 .elementor-cta__content{text-align:center;padding:0px 0px 0px 0px;}.elementor-13669 .elementor-element.elementor-element-4577679 .elementor-cta__button{font-family:"HvDTrial_PlutoCondBlack", Sans-serif;font-size:24px;text-transform:none;color:#FFFFFF;background-color:#02010100;border-color:#02010100;border-width:0px;border-radius:0px;padding:15px 15px 15px 15px;}.elementor-13669 .elementor-element.elementor-element-4577679 .elementor-cta__button:hover{color:#FFFFFF;background-color:#02010100;}.elementor-13669 .elementor-element.elementor-element-4577679 .elementor-cta:not(:hover) .elementor-cta__bg-overlay{background-color:#02010100;}.elementor-13669 .elementor-element.elementor-element-4577679 .elementor-cta:hover .elementor-cta__bg-overlay{background-color:#02010100;}.elementor-13669 .elementor-element.elementor-element-6514a9a{--e-n-carousel-swiper-slides-to-display:4;--e-n-carousel-swiper-slides-gap:10px;width:100%;max-width:100%;padding:0px 70px 0px 70px;--e-n-carousel-slide-height:auto;--e-n-carousel-slide-container-height:100%;--e-n-carousel-arrow-prev-left-align:0%;--e-n-carousel-arrow-prev-translate-x:0px;--e-n-carousel-arrow-prev-left-position:0px;--e-n-carousel-arrow-prev-top-align:50%;--e-n-carousel-arrow-prev-translate-y:-50%;--e-n-carousel-arrow-prev-top-position:0px;--e-n-carousel-arrow-next-right-align:0%;--e-n-carousel-arrow-next-translate-x:0%;--e-n-carousel-arrow-next-right-position:0px;--e-n-carousel-arrow-next-top-align:50%;--e-n-carousel-arrow-next-translate-y:-50%;--e-n-carousel-arrow-next-top-position:0px;}.elementor-13669 .elementor-element.elementor-element-8cf6f6f{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--padding-top:30px;--padding-bottom:30px;--padding-left:0px;--padding-right:0px;}.elementor-widget-button .elementor-button{background-color:var( --e-global-color-accent );font-family:var( --e-global-typography-accent-font-family ), Sans-serif;}.elementor-13669 .elementor-element.elementor-element-782a732 .elementor-button{background-color:#35353900;font-family:"HvDTrial_PlutoCondBlack", Sans-serif;font-size:26px;text-transform:none;text-shadow:0px 5px 5px rgba(0, 0, 0, 0.14);padding:19px 0px 19px 0px;}.elementor-13669 .elementor-element.elementor-element-782a732{width:var( --container-widget-width, 290px );max-width:290px;background-image:url("https://lavenderac.stg2.ciwgserver.com/wp-content/uploads/2024/02/btn1b.webp");--container-widget-width:290px;--container-widget-flex-grow:0;background-position:center center;background-repeat:no-repeat;background-size:100% auto;}.elementor-13669 .elementor-element.elementor-element-782a732:hover{background-image:url("https://lavenderac.stg2.ciwgserver.com/wp-content/uploads/2024/02/btn1v.webp");}.elementor-13669 .elementor-element.elementor-element-782a732.elementor-element{--align-self:center;}@media(max-width:1500px){.elementor-13669 .elementor-element.elementor-element-6514a9a{--e-n-carousel-swiper-slides-gap:0px;}.elementor-13669 .elementor-element.elementor-element-782a732{--container-widget-width:280px;--container-widget-flex-grow:0;width:var( --container-widget-width, 280px );max-width:280px;}.elementor-13669 .elementor-element.elementor-element-782a732 .elementor-button{font-size:24px;}}@media(max-width:1200px){.elementor-13669 .elementor-element.elementor-element-113d285{--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-13669 .elementor-element.elementor-element-7eb7b95 .elementor-cta__button{font-size:22px;}.elementor-13669 .elementor-element.elementor-element-b72a86d .elementor-cta__button{font-size:22px;}.elementor-13669 .elementor-element.elementor-element-1e2a572 .elementor-cta__button{font-size:22px;}.elementor-13669 .elementor-element.elementor-element-cc42510 .elementor-cta__button{font-size:22px;}.elementor-13669 .elementor-element.elementor-element-4577679 .elementor-cta__button{font-size:22px;}.elementor-13669 .elementor-element.elementor-element-6514a9a{--e-n-carousel-swiper-slides-to-display:3;padding:0px 20px 0px 20px;}.elementor-13669 .elementor-element.elementor-element-782a732{--container-widget-width:260px;--container-widget-flex-grow:0;width:var( --container-widget-width, 260px );max-width:260px;}.elementor-13669 .elementor-element.elementor-element-782a732 .elementor-button{font-size:22px;}}@media(max-width:767px){.elementor-13669 .elementor-element.elementor-element-7eb7b95 .elementor-cta__button{font-size:20px;}.elementor-13669 .elementor-element.elementor-element-b72a86d .elementor-cta__button{font-size:20px;}.elementor-13669 .elementor-element.elementor-element-1e2a572 .elementor-cta__button{font-size:20px;}.elementor-13669 .elementor-element.elementor-element-cc42510 .elementor-cta__button{font-size:20px;}.elementor-13669 .elementor-element.elementor-element-4577679 .elementor-cta__button{font-size:20px;}.elementor-13669 .elementor-element.elementor-element-6514a9a{--e-n-carousel-swiper-slides-to-display:1;}}@media(min-width:768px){.elementor-13669 .elementor-element.elementor-element-113d285{--content-width:1400px;}}/* Start custom CSS for nested-carousel, class: .elementor-element-6514a9a */#hm-services-siider #ser-itm {width:270px;}


#hm-services-siider #ser-itm .elementor-cta__content { background-color:#fff;}
#hm-services-siider #ser-itm .elementor-cta__image  { width:258px;
height:258px;
text-align: center;
display: flex;
flex-direction: column;
align-items: center;
justify-content: center;
background:url(/wp-content/uploads/2024/02/serbg1.webp) center center no-repeat;
background-size:100% 100%;
margin: 0px auto
}

#hm-services-siider #ser-itm .elementor-cta__image img { 
    max-width: 120px
}

@media (max-width:1200px) {


#hm-services-siider #ser-itm .elementor-cta__image img { 
    max-width: 100px
}
}

#hm-services-siider #ser-itm .elementor-cta__image { }

#hm-services-siider #ser-itm:hover .elementor-cta__image {background-image:url(/wp-content/uploads/2024/02/serbg2.webp)} 

#hm-services-siider #ser-itm .elementor-cta__button {background:url(/wp-content/uploads/2024/02/btn2v.webp) center center no-repeat;
background-size:100% 100%;
width:270px;
margin:20px auto}

#hm-services-siider #ser-itm .elementor-cta__button:hover { background-image:url(/wp-content/uploads/2024/02/btn2b.webp)}

#hm-services-siider #ser-itm:hover .elementor-cta__image:after {content:url(/wp-content/uploads/2024/02/ser-iaq2.webp);
    width: 100%;
    height: 100%;
    position: absolute;
    left: 0px;
    top: 8px;
   
    text-align: center;
display: flex;
flex-direction: column;
align-items: center;
justify-content: center;
}

#hm-services-siider #ser-itm:hover .elementor-cta__image img { display:none;}


#hm-services-siider #ser-itm.ser2:hover .elementor-cta__image:after {content:url(/wp-content/uploads/2024/02/ser-heating2.webp);
}

#hm-services-siider #ser-itm.ser3:hover .elementor-cta__image:after {content:url(/wp-content/uploads/2024/02/ser-ac2.webp);
}


#hm-services-siider #ser-itm.ser4:hover .elementor-cta__image:after {content:url(/wp-content/uploads/2024/02/ser-mini-split2.webp);
top:6px;
}





#hm-services-siider #ser-itm.ser5:hover .elementor-cta__image:after {content:url(/wp-content/uploads/2024/02/blow-in-instulation2.webp);
top:6px;
}



@media(max-width:1500px) {



#hm-services-siider #ser-itm .elementor-cta__button {font-size:20px;}

#hm-services-siider #ser-itm .elementor-cta__button{max-width:100%;}
}

@media(max-width:1100px) {

#hm-services-siider #ser-itm {width:240px;}

#hm-services-siider #ser-itm .elementor-cta__image  { width:230px;
height:230px;
}

#hm-services-siider #ser-itm .elementor-cta__button {
width:100%;
}
}


@media(max-width:1100px) {



#hm-services-siider #ser-itm .elementor-cta__button {font-size:19px;}
}

@media(max-width:800px) {

#hm-services-siider #ser-itm {width:210px;}

#hm-services-siider #ser-itm .elementor-cta__image  { width:200px;
height:200px;
}

#hm-services-siider #ser-itm .elementor-cta__button {
width:100%;
}

#hm-services-siider #ser-itm .elementor-cta__button {font-size:17px;}
}

#hm-services-siider .elementor-swiper-button {
background-repeat: no-repeat;
background-position: center center;

background-size: 21px 17px;
border-radius:100%;
}

#hm-services-siider .elementor-swiper-button:hover {background-size: 18px 14px;}

#hm-services-siider .elementor-swiper-button i {
visibility: hidden
}

#hm-services-siider .elementor-swiper-button.elementor-swiper-button-prev {
background-image: url(/wp-content/uploads/2024/02/arwl1.webp);


}

#hm-services-siider .elementor-swiper-button.elementor-swiper-button-prev:hover {

}

#hm-services-siider .elementor-swiper-button.elementor-swiper-button-next {
background-image: url(/wp-content/uploads/2024/02/arwr1.webp);
}

#hm-services-siider .elementor-swiper-button.elementor-swiper-button-next:hover {

}/* End custom CSS */